Ethical Considerations of AI in Healthcare: Navigating Challenges and Ensuring Equity

The integration of artificial intelligence techniques into healthcare presents a substantial opportunity to enhance patient care and optimize systems. However, this transformative technology also raises numerous ethical concerns that demand careful scrutiny. One paramount concern is the risk of algorithmic bias, which can unequally impact marginalized populations, exacerbating existing health inequities. It is essential to develop and implement AI solutions that are explainable, ensuring Artificial intelligence in health care and it future to come fairness and justice in healthcare delivery.

  • Another critical ethical aspect is the preservation of patient privacy and anonymity. AI-powered tools often process private health data, raising concerns about potential breaches and misuse. Stringent dataprotection measures must be established to preserve patient information and maintain public trust.
  • Furthermore, the increasing reliance on AI in healthcare raises concerns about the function of human clinicians. It is crucial to strike a equilibrium between leveraging AI's capabilities and preserving the empathetic care that is fundamental to effective healthcare.

Navigating these ethical dilemmas requires a multi-faceted strategy involving actors from across the healthcare ecosystem. This includes , ethicists, policymakers, patients, and technology developers working collaboratively to define principles that promote responsible and equitable use of AI in healthcare.

Unveiling Operational Excellence through Data

In today's rapidly evolving healthcare landscape, the ability to leverage data-driven insights is paramount. Artificial intelligence (AI) technologies are revolutionizing healthcare operations and resource allocation by providing unprecedented analytical capabilities. By analyzing vast pools of information, AI algorithms can identify trends that would be difficult or impossible for humans to detect. These insights enable healthcare organizations to optimize various aspects of their operations, including resource utilization. For example, AI-powered predictive models can forecast patient admissions, allowing hospitals to proactively allocate resources and reduce wait times.

Through data-driven decision making, healthcare providers can enhance patient outcomes, streamline operations, and maximize efficiency.
